CAN-总线基础.ppt

  1. 1、有哪些信誉好的足球投注网站(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
  2. 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  3. 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
CAN总线基础 Peng Yang - CAN总线的起源 - CAN总线的起源 - CAN总线的起源 -车载网络的构想 - CAN的应用示例 -什么是CAN? CAN 是Controller Area Network 的缩写(以下称为CAN),是德国Bosch公司为解决现代汽车中众多控制单元、测试仪器之间的实时数据交换而开发的一种串行通信协议 。 - CAN总线拓扑图 - CAN总线的特点 - CAN总线的特点 - CAN总线的特点 - CAN总线的特点 - CAN总线的特点 - CAN总线的应用 - CAN总线的应用 - CAN总线的应用 CAPL浏览器/编程 CAPL的事件类型 CANoe的应用 CAPL浏览器/编程 CAPL的基本语法 -CAPL语言的语法和C语言基本相同 注释 // 放置在需要注释的语句之前,注释单行 /* 注释起始符,其后的内容被注释 */ 注释结束符,结束由/*开始的注释 事件过程 分号 大括号 CANoe的应用 CAPL浏览器/编程 键盘过程 CANoe的应用 CAPL浏览器/编程 时间过程 CANoe的应用 CANdb++编辑器 创建CAN数据库的步骤 1、启动CANdb++程序 2、设立一个新的CAN数据库 3、对象的创建与修改 4、复制已有的对象 5、修改已有的对象 6、链接对象 7、显示通信矩阵 8、创建与分配数值表 9、创建自定义属性,并修改自定义属性值 10、执行一致性检查及必要的修正 CANoe的应用 CANdb++编辑器 创建CAN数据库的步骤 1、启动CANdb++程序 或 CANoe的应用 CANdb++编辑器 创建CAN数据库的步骤 2、设立一个新的CAN数据库 选择菜单命令File | Create Database… 选择模板,鼠标双击或按[OK]按钮 指定文件类型、文件名及保存目录 按SAVE按钮后完成一个新数据库创建 CANoe的应用 CANdb++编辑器 创建CAN数据库的步骤 3、对象的创建与修改 在Overview窗口左边选择所需创建对象的类型 使用菜单命令Edit|New… ,打开新对象的配置对话框 使用配置对话框设置所创建对象的系统参数值. 点击[确定]按钮,一个新对象便创建完毕. CANoe的应用 CANdb++编辑器 创建CAN数据库的步骤 4、复制已有的对象 选择需要复制的对象 使用菜单命令Edit/Copy复制对象(或用右键) 使用菜单命令Edit/Paste粘贴对象(或用右键) 对复制的对象进行修改 CANoe的应用 在Overview窗口右边 的表中直接修改 通过对象对话框进行修改 CANdb++编辑器 创建CAN数据库的步骤 5、修改已有的对象 CANoe的应用 CANdb++编辑器 创建CAN数据库的步骤 6、链接对象 对象的链接旨在建立对象之间的关系: 1、信号与消息之间的关系 2、消息与节点之间的关系 可以使用命令菜单 或者鼠标直接 拖动来实现 用信号关联接收模块 用消息去关联发送模块 CANoe的应用 CANdb++编辑器 创建CAN数据库的步骤 7、显示通信矩阵 1、显示信号、消息、及网络 节点的关系 2、以信号为行,网络节点为列 3、消息名显示于表中,对应了 包含的信号与发送/接收的节点 CANoe的应用 CANdb++编辑器 创建CAN数据库的步骤 8、创建与分配数值表 用符号标识符来表示信号值或环境变量值: 选择菜单命令View| Value Tables,打开数值表窗口 选择菜单命令Edit | New ,打开数值表对象对话框 修改数值或符号标识符 按[OK]按钮,完成创建 CANoe的应用 CANdb++编辑器 创建CAN数据库的步骤 8、创建与分配数值表 数值表的分配: 数值表必须明确地指派给某个信号或环境变量,表中所定义的数值符号标识符才能真正地与信号或环境变量值关联起来。 分配操作在相应的信号或环境变量对象对话框的Value Table选项中选择。 CANoe的应用 CANdb++编辑器 创建CAN数据库的步骤 9、创建自定义属性 使用菜单命令View | Attribute Definitions打开属性定义窗口 使用菜单命令Edit | New打开属性定义(Attribute Definition )对象对话框 修改自定义属性的参数。 对话框设置完毕,按[OK]或 [确定]按钮。 CANoe的应用 CANdb++编辑器 创建CAN数据库的步骤 9、创建自定义属性 修改对象的自定义属性值: 使用对象对话框修改 在Overview窗口或对象列表窗口中修改 CANoe的应用 CANdb++编辑器 创建CAN数据库的步骤 10、执行一致性

文档评论(0)

wnqwwy20 + 关注
实名认证
内容提供者

该用户很懒,什么也没介绍

版权声明书
用户编号:7014141164000003

1亿VIP精品文档

相关文档